Pacquiao to Robredo: 'Thank you for trusting me'


Senator Emmanuel ‘’Manny’’ D. Pacquiao on Monday, September 6, said he is thankful to Vice- President Leni Robredo for trusting him.

Pacquiao issued this statement after Robredo was quoted as saying that she is open to supporting a "Moreno-Pacquiao" tandem if it would be enough to end President Duterte’s kind of governance.

Manila Mayor Francisco "Isko Moreno" Domagoso also has presidential ambitions like Pacquiao.

Pacquiao, however, has yet to confirm whether or not to run for the country's highest elective post next year.

‘’Tulad ng nasabi ko ay pinag-iisipan ko pang mabuti kung alin sa tatlong option ang pinagpipilian ko: ang presidency, ang tumakbo bilang senador o ang tuluyan nang magretiro sa pulitika (As I have previously said, I will soon be making an decision on whether I would seek the presidency, run for a reelection or retire from politics)," he said in a statement.

‘’At kung sakali man na ako ay mag desisyon na tumakbo, sana ay masuportahan ninyo ang aking hangarin para sa kapayapaan at kaunlaran ng ating bansa (And if I decide to run, I hope you will support me as I wish for a peaceful and progressive Philippines),’’ he stressed.

Pacquiao further said: ‘’Gusto kong makita sa kulungan ang mga magnanakaw sa ating pamahalaan na siyang dahilan ng paghihirap ng ating mga kababayan (I want to see the thieves in this government go to jail because they are the ones causing misery among our countrymen)."

‘’Maraming-maraming salamat po ulit sa inyong pagtitiwala (Thank you so much for your trust in me),’’ he told Robredo.
